Portugal - Hospital Average Length of Stay for Paralytic Ileus and Intestinal Obstruction Without Hernia
Since 2013, Portugal Hospital Average Length of Stay for Paralytic Ileus and Intestinal Obstruction Without Hernia rose 2.1% year on year. In 2018, the country was ranked number 5 among other countries in Hospital Average Length of Stay for Paralytic Ileus and Intestinal Obstruction Without Hernia at 10.2 Days. Portugal is overtaken by Ireland, which was number 4 with 10.6 Days and is followed by Poland with 9.1 Days. Slovenia topped the ranking with 11.5 Days in 2019, that is stable versus 2018. Portugal recorded the best 5 years average growth at +2.1% per year, while Finland recorded the worst performance at -5.7% per year.
